Runbook: Pellwick public REST API pagination. All list endpoints return cursor-based pages with a default size of 50 and a hard cap of 200. Clients pass the next_cursor value from the previous response; cursors expire after 15 minutes, so long exports must be resumed via the export service instead. If a partner reports duplicate or missing records, check whether they are mixing offset and cursor parameters, which the gateway silently ignores. The endpoint reference and cursor troubleshooting guide are on the internal page below.

operations page: https://jenkins.zemvarcloud.local/job/merge_requests/repo/build/73930b4b30f0a8ed

Briefing — Leadership Review, Ostrand Mercantile Group

Prepared for the finance team regarding the proposed inventory write-down at the Calloway distribution centre. Obsolete Ferrowline components, carried at full cost since the model refresh, will be impaired by approximately forty percent. Auditors have reviewed the methodology and concur with the valuation approach. Cash impact is nil; earnings impact lands in Q4. The decision connects to broader plans, summarised confidentially below.

board note of fadug-yafog: Only 39 of the 474 pilot accounts renewed Belion, so a churn review is set for September 6. Wenixax Logistics is in early talks to buy Gorirek Systems for about $270.9 million.

## Bounce Processor — Restart Procedure

If the Mirelight bounce processor stalls, drain the intake queue first, then restart the worker pods one at a time. Check that suppression-list writes resume within two minutes. Never clear the dedupe cache during business hours. Verify the restarted service loads the expected settings, which are listed here.

settings of fajog-kaweg:
[pramir]
port = 11211
team = kasath
host = pramir.tolvaqio.test
region = south-4
access_code = ac_1c8aca
timeout_ms = 3000

- [ ] Show the new starter the goods lift at the back of Hartwell House. Quick heads-up: it's reserved for deliveries only, so no hopping in with your lunch! If they're expecting courier drop-offs for the Meridian team, they'll need to book a slot via the loading bay sheet. The lift panel won't respond to a standard tap, as it runs on a separate keypad. The code they'll need is below.

door code, yagap-bahof: bdg-O-05